04 января | 2025г. | 14:05:58


АвторТема: Эмулятор/кардсервер OScam платформы mipsel (Обсуждение) (part 3)  (Прочитано 129650 раз)

0 Пользователей и 2 Гостей смотрят эту тему.

Оффлайн oys

  • Друзья Джедаев
  • *****
  • Сообщений: 2579
  • Поблагодарили: 15620
  • Уважение: +432
Changeset 11690

buildfix
module-dvbapi.c:262:5: warning: Value stored to 'ret' is never read [deadcode.DeadStores?]
-> ret = send(fd, &request, sizeof(request), 0);
module-dvbapi.c:2469:11: warning: Value stored to 'currentfd' is never read [deadcode.DeadStores?]
-> currentfd = ca_fd = 0;
module-dvbapi.c:3325:2: warning: Value stored to 'p_order' is never read [deadcode.DeadStores?]
-> p_order = demux[demux_id].ECMpidcount + 1;
module-dvbapi.c:7102:6: warning: Value stored to 'connfd' is never read [deadcode.DeadStores?]
-> connfd = -1; initially no socket to read from
module-dvbapi.c:7179:8: warning: Value stored to 'connfd' is never read [deadcode.DeadStores?]
-> connfd = -1;

 @ gorgone


Оффлайн JohnDoe

  • Младший Джедай
  • **
  • Сообщений: 197
  • Поблагодарили: 151
  • Уважение: 0
я до некоторого времени пользовался wicardd, но сейчас решил попробовать OSCam ymod v.1859
покурил темы с обсуждениями, вики стримбордовский,
конфиг у меня не сильно сложный - только нтв+
хотел бы посоветоваться, правильно ли я всё понял
сам конфиг:
Спойлер   oscam.conf:
[global]
#logfile = /tmp/oscam.log;syslog:192.168.1.35:514
#maxlogsize = 100
logfile = syslog:192.168.1.35:514
ecminfo_type = 2
#clienttimeout = 5000
#fallbacktimeout = 2500

#[webif]
#httpport = 8082
#httpallowed = 192.168.1.1-192.168.1.254

[dvbapi]
enabled = 1
user = root
#chaninfo = 1
pmt_mode = 6

# Stapi Tuner 1 (Openbox S)
#S: PTI pmt1_1.tmp
#S: PTI pmt1_2.tmp
#S: PTI pmt1_3.tmp
# Stapi Tuner 2 (Openbox S)
#S: PTI1 pmt2_1.tmp
#S: PTI1 pmt2_2.tmp
#S: PTI1 pmt2_3.tmp
# Stapi Timeshift (Openbox S)
#S: PTI2 pmt3_1.tmp

# Stapi5 Tuner 1 (Openbox SX)
#S: PTI3 pmt1_1.tmp
#S: PTI3 pmt1_2.tmp
#S: PTI3 pmt1_3.tmp
#S: PTI3 pmt1_4.tmp
#S: PTI3 pmt1_5.tmp

# Android ARM Openbox AS4K or Formuler 4K (firmware < 1.6.7 r14249)
#S: stapi1 pmt1_1.tmp
#S: stapi1 pmt1_2.tmp
#S: stapi1 pmt1_3.tmp
#S: stapi1 pmt1_4.tmp
#S: stapi1 pmt1_5.tmp

#S: stapi1 pmt2_1.tmp
#S: stapi1 pmt2_2.tmp
#S: stapi1 pmt2_3.tmp
#S: stapi1 pmt2_4.tmp
#S: stapi1 pmt2_5.tmp

# Android ARM Openbox AS4K or Formuler 4K (firmware ≥ 1.6.7 r14249)
#S: stapi1 pmt3_1.tmp
#S: stapi1 pmt3_2.tmp
#S: stapi1 pmt3_3.tmp
#S: stapi1 pmt3_4.tmp
#S: stapi1 pmt3_5.tmp

#S: stapi1 pmt4_1.tmp
#S: stapi1 pmt4_2.tmp
#S: stapi1 pmt4_3.tmp
#S: stapi1 pmt4_4.tmp
#S: stapi1 pmt4_5.tmp

P:0500:060C00 # НТВ+ 36E
P:0500:060A00 # НТВ+ 36E
I:0

[servername0 newcamd serverurl0 port01;port02 login01 pass02 killbadcw = 1 keepalive = 1 reconnecttimeoutsec = 30 fallback = 0] # Основной сервер
[servername1 newcamd serverurl1 port11;port12 login11 pass12 killbadcw = 1 keepalive = 1 reconnecttimeoutsec = 30 fallback = 1] # Резервный (позапросный) сервер

[account]
user = root
group = 1



небольшие комментарии, почему так:
ecminfo_type = 2 - прост привык к выводу а-ля wicardd (кста с "3" под mgcamd вообще ничего не выводит почему-то);
#clienttimeout = 5000
и
#fallbacktimeout = 2500 - закомментированы, 5000/2500 для стримбордовского, у юрика - 6000/3000, оставил так
#chaninfo = 1 - говорят, подвисает с этим параметром в некоторых случаях
pmt_mode = 6 - реально открывает с "6" шустрее, почему - не знаю, подсмотрел здесь на форуме
для Stapi Tuner подсмотрел тут, для stapi5 и arm - на разных бордах
с серверами
[servername0 newcamd serverurl0 port01;port02 login01 pass02 killbadcw = 1 keepalive = 1 reconnecttimeoutsec = 30 fallback = 0] # Основной сервер
[servername1 newcamd serverurl1 port11;port12 login11 pass12 killbadcw = 1 keepalive = 1 reconnecttimeoutsec = 30 fallback = 1] # Резервный (позапросный) сервер

вроде всё понятно
но нужны ли keepalive = 1 и reconnecttimeoutsec ?

хотел, кстати, сделать вот так
P:0500:060C00 1 # НТВ+ 36E
P:0500:060A00 # НТВ+ 36E

но не совсем понял, как это работает, т.к. я предполагал, что отдаётся приоритет 060C00,
что собственно так и есть,
но если убрать его из ридера, оставив только 060A00, то при этой единичке на 060C00 - на 060A00 не перескочит, и канал не откроет, т.к. в приоритете 060C00 и хоть трава не расти, если его на ридере нет, значит и кина не будет
в общем, не понял его смысл

Если кто подскажет чего: добавить там, убрать - буду благодарен

Оффлайн Evg77734

  • Совет Джедаев
  • **
  • Сообщений: 1412
  • Поблагодарили: 8875
  • Уважение: +152
в общем, не понял его смысл
По моему вы слишком заморачиваетесь, основной сервер годами работает без единого затыка, время резервных давно прошло, если конечно это не бесплатные тесты, тогда и говорить не о чем.
В секции [dvbapi] еще нужна строка boxtype = dreambox, а в секции [account] строка pwd = drembox
Ну, а в каждом ридере желательно указывать caid:ident, чтобы он точно понимал, что вы от него хотите, например:
[Telekarta newcamd сервер порт логин пароль ident=0b00:000000]
Если этого не делать, то порядок открытия по caid будет определяться тем, в каком порядке у вас прописаны приоритеты:
P:0500:060C00 # НТВ+ 36E
P:0500:060A00 # НТВ+ 36E
Строка chaninfo = 1 не влияет на скорость никак, просто из потока будут извлекаться имена каналов и записываться в файл oscam.srvid и в дальнейшем имена каналов будут отражаться в логе, но только если они на латинице, если имя на кирилице - в логе кракозябры, лечится или правкой вручную или можно воспользоваться программкой BuildOscamSrv.exe 

Оффлайн JohnDoe

  • Младший Джедай
  • **
  • Сообщений: 197
  • Поблагодарили: 151
  • Уважение: 0
Evg77734, благодарю
я прост перфекционист, да и для себя что-то поправить мне не составляет труда
нет, я не про бесплатные естественно,
но я обратил внимание, что если прописать позапроску в качестве резерва к основному, то затыков нет вообще, а раньше на основном замечал редкие - наверное, перезагружался основной шаросервер по крону
но опять же да, всё от сервера и качества услуг зависит тоже конечно

по chaninfo - да, я не про скорость, а читал, что бывали у людей подвисания,
не на поледней версии автор даже рекомендовал закомментить, но далее в чейнджлоге я не видел, чтобы он это пофиксил в последней
И BuildOscamSrv тоже пробовал - у меня всё равно были кракозябры, не помогло

Оффлайн Cybergal

  • Падаван
  • *
  • Сообщений: 40
  • Поблагодарили: 44
  • Уважение: 0
Может кто в последний Oscam-Emu эмулятор TNTSat ( France ) который уже с Марта месяца на только оной версии Oscama работает добавить ?

Оффлайн oys

  • Друзья Джедаев
  • *****
  • Сообщений: 2579
  • Поблагодарили: 15620
  • Уважение: +432
Cybergal, я переименовал oscam на oscam-1.25 и на мерлине4-dm900 работает без проблем . Последние версий не рабочие .
Спойлер   :
[ Гостям не разрешен просмотр вложений ][ Гостям не разрешен просмотр вложений ]
Спойлер   :
[ Гостям не разрешен просмотр вложений ]

Оффлайн Evg77734

  • Совет Джедаев
  • **
  • Сообщений: 1412
  • Поблагодарили: 8875
  • Уважение: +152
Может кто в .... добавить ?
Нет. Это была экспериментальная версия оскама 11678
Спойлер   :
18:35:10 00000000 s >> OSCam << cardserver log switched, version 1.20_svn, build r11678
18:35:10 0BD544CB r   (reader) tntsat [tntsat] Reader initialized (device=tntsat, detect=cd, mhz=357, cardmhz=357)
18:35:11 0BD544CB r   (reader) tntsat [tntsat] card detected
18:35:12 0BD544CB r   (reader) tntsat [tntsat] found card system tntsat
18:35:12 0BD544CB r   (reader) tntsat [tntsat] THIS WAS A SUCCESSFUL START ATTEMPT No  1 out of max allotted of 1
И многие там получили бан, за то что выложили это в открытый доступ. На последних версиях не должно и не будет работать.

Оффлайн Cybergal

  • Падаван
  • *
  • Сообщений: 40
  • Поблагодарили: 44
  • Уважение: 0
Кто обьяснит в двух словах кто такой "Plugin RevCamv2 _emu" и кому он нужен ?
У меня правда DM900 но смысл наверно такой же как и у MIPS...

Оффлайн Evg77734

  • Совет Джедаев
  • **
  • Сообщений: 1412
  • Поблагодарили: 8875
  • Уважение: +152

Оффлайн Cybergal

  • Падаван
  • *
  • Сообщений: 40
  • Поблагодарили: 44
  • Уважение: 0
Я это видел но не пойму кому это надо и кто там чего предлогает ?
Где отличие от Oscam ? Помоему это тупик и пахнет непонятной коммерцией ....

Оффлайн uno-duo

  • Джедай
  • ***
  • Сообщений: 378
  • Поблагодарили: 216
  • Уважение: +3
Донастройка OSCAM для показа ш@ры +++
- Откройте файл oscam.server.
- Добавьте в секцию [reader] новую строку:
Вам не разрешен просмотр кода. Войдите или Зарегистрируйтесь для просмотра.- Перезапустите эмулятор
  • Vu+ Uno | Vu+ Solo 2
TV: LG55LM640T                            TV: Sharp LC-46XL2RU
Receiver: Vu+ Uno                         Receiver: Vu+ Solo2
Image: Black Hole                          Image: OpenPLi

Оффлайн kolik2020

  • Младший Джедай
  • **
  • Сообщений: 82
  • Поблагодарили: 19
  • Уважение: +1
у меня так не завелся а вот с этими disablecrccws = 1
dontcorrectcwchecksum=1 завелся

Оффлайн Dmitrich

  • Подающий Надежды
  • *
  • Сообщений: 1
  • Поблагодарили: 0
  • Уважение: 0
коллеги, подскажите, какой из последних версий oscam можно обновиться на ресивере dm800se?

Оффлайн hecha71

  • Друзья Джедаев
  • *****
  • Сообщений: 2168
  • Поблагодарили: 9873
  • Уважение: +269
Dmitrich, может всётаки просто одну строчку в ридер добавить? если всё работало на оскаме
понимаете поменять оскам можно но без рукоприкладства всё ровно не обойтись и править в файле  oscam.server  ридер который отвечает за +++ по любому надо.

dm800se
имидж openpli-enigma2-11.2-dm800se.nfi в нём уже предустановлен автором сборки  оскам-добавил свой файл oscam.server  добавленной строчкой в ридере +++
открывает без проблем
Спойлер   :
[ Гостям не разрешен просмотр вложений ][ Гостям не разрешен просмотр вложений ]
  • DM 900 UHD,Octagon8008_4K,DM820HD,DM800SE_V2,DM500HD(A8P),DM800SE(A8P),Vu+DUO2,Solo2...
"Only a strong-minded person scores a dick on everything and everyone that is against him"

Оффлайн uno-duo

  • Джедай
  • ***
  • Сообщений: 378
  • Поблагодарили: 216
  • Уважение: +3
у меня так не завелся а вот с этими disablecrccws = 1
dontcorrectcwchecksum=1 завелся
Строка dontcorrectcwchecksum=1 нужна для oscam ymod 1859.
Для oscam svm достаточно disablecrccws = 1
  • Vu+ Uno | Vu+ Solo 2
TV: LG55LM640T                            TV: Sharp LC-46XL2RU
Receiver: Vu+ Uno                         Receiver: Vu+ Solo2
Image: Black Hole                          Image: OpenPLi

Теги:
 



X

Добро пожаловать!

Мы заметили, что у Вас установлено расширение AdBlock или ему подобное. Пожалуйста добавьте наш Клуб в белый список, внесите этим посильную лепту в его развитие. Спасибо!